Chelsea at risk of losing £70m from summer transfer budget
Chelsea boss Enzo Maresca could see his transfer budget slashed by £70million, if the Blues fail to qualify for the Champions League.
After losing out on four points in their last two Premier League matches, Chelsea have fallen to the sixth position on the league table and are now at the risk of losing out on a top-five finish and missing out on a Champions League slot. While failing to qualify for the Champions League might not affect manager Maresca's position at the club, the Italian coach could see his transfer budget slashed to £70 million ($90m), according to The SunSport.

Delap unlikely to accept United Offer
Liam Delap is reportedly leaning towards turning down a potential move to Manchester United during the upcoming transfer window, as per a report by The Daily Express.
The 22-year-old has a strong desire to compete at the European level, and clubs like Chelsea and Arsenal are believed to be high on his list of preferred options should a transfer materialise this summer. Delap has impressed in his current campaign with Ipswich Town, having found the net 12 times in the Premier League since making the move from Manchester City last year.

Villa push to secure rising Norwegian midfielder
Aston Villa are making a strong effort to secure the services of Sverre Nypan, with hopes of outpacing Premier League rivals Arsenal for his signature, as reported by The Athletic.
Nypan, only 18 years old, is already representing Norway at the Under-21 level and has earned attention from clubs across Europe thanks to his composed displays in midfield. His performances have also sparked interest from LaLiga outfit Girona.

Chelsea are monitoring Brighton star Rutter
Chelsea are actively keeping tabs on Georginio Rutter, according to Sky Germany.
Although currently sidelined due to a foot injury, Rutter has enjoyed a standout season with Brighton. His contributions include eight goals and four assists, showcasing his effectiveness both as a scorer and creator when fit. His current contract runs until 2028, meaning any negotiations would likely require a significant fee.
